Per Diem PMHNP Jobs in Albuquerque: Quick Facts

As of April 2026, there are 7 per diem PMHNP positions available in Albuquerque, NM. The average salary for these positions is $133K per year, which is approximately $143K when adjusted for Albuquerque's cost of living index (93). Albuquerque has a population of 564,559 and is designated as a Mental Health Professional Shortage Area (HPSA), indicating high demand for psychiatric providers. New Mexico is a full practice authority state for nurse practitioners. The typical salary range for per diem roles is $80-150/hr.

Sources: U.S. Census Bureau, Bureau of Labor Statistics, HRSA HPSA data. Updated April 2026.

What qualifications do I need for per diem PMHNP jobs?

To work as a PMHNP in Albuquerque, you need: a Master's or Doctoral degree in psychiatric-mental health nursing, ANCC PMHNP-BC certification, an active RN and APRN license in New Mexico, and DEA registration for prescribing controlled substances.
